Adolph Tidemand's painting Kvinne i halvfigur, Vikøy (translated as Woman in Half Figure, Vikøy) is a work by the renowned Norwegian artist Adolph Tidemand (1814–1876). Tidemand is widely recognized as one of Norway's most significant painters of the 19th century, particularly for his contributions to the Romantic Nationalism movement. His works often depict Norwegian rural life, traditional customs, and folk culture, which were central themes during a period when Norway was seeking to establish a distinct national identity.

Kvinne i halvfigur, Vikøy portrays a woman in traditional Norwegian attire, depicted in a half-figure composition. The title suggests that the setting or inspiration for the painting is Vikøy, a village in the municipality of Kvam in Hordaland County, Norway. Vikøy is known for its scenic landscapes and cultural heritage, which may have influenced Tidemand's choice of subject matter. The painting reflects Tidemand's characteristic attention to detail, particularly in the rendering of traditional costumes, which were often a focal point in his works. These costumes were not only a visual element but also a symbol of Norwegian identity and heritage during the 19th century.

Tidemand's art is often celebrated for its ability to capture the dignity and simplicity of rural Norwegian life. His works were informed by extensive travels throughout Norway, during which he sketched and documented local customs, clothing, and architecture. These studies provided the foundation for many of his paintings, including Kvinne i halvfigur, Vikøy. While the specific date of this painting is not widely documented, it is consistent with Tidemand's broader body of work, which frequently explored themes of Norwegian rural life and tradition.

As with many of Tidemand's paintings, Kvinne i halvfigur, Vikøy likely resonated with contemporary audiences who were eager to celebrate and preserve Norway's cultural heritage. His works played a significant role in shaping the visual representation of Norwegian identity during a time of national awakening.

Further details about the painting, such as its current location or provenance, are not readily available in existing records. However, it remains an example of Tidemand's dedication to portraying the cultural richness of Norway through his art.
